ISM: Manufacturing expansion continues

Economic activity in the manufacturing sector expanded in June for the 23rd consecutive month, according to the latest Manufacturing ISM Report On Business.


The PMI registered 55.3 percent, an increase of 1.8 percentage points when compared to May's reading of 53.5 percent.

"New orders and production were both modestly up from last month, and employment showed continued strength with an increase of 1.7 percentage points to 59.9 percent," said Bradley J. Holcomb, CPSM, CPSD, chair of the Institute for Supply Management Manufacturing Business Survey Committee. "The rate of increase in prices slowed for the second consecutive month, dropping 8.5 percentage points in June to 68 percent. This follows a similar reduction of 9 percentage points in the Prices Index in May, and is the lowest figure since August 2010 when the index registered 61.5 percent. While the rate of price increases has slowed and the list of commodities up in price has shortened, commodity and input prices continue to be a concern across several industries."
